WebThe physical change you should observe is the copper-colored metal vanishing as the solution turns blue (from [Cu(H2O)6]2+, the hexaaquacopper ion) and a brown gas (NO2) is evolved. Cu (s) + 4 H3O+(aq) + 2 NO3-(aq) --> [Cu(H2O)6]2+(aq) + 2 NO2(g) Hydroxide ion (OH-) binds to the copper (II)ion even more strongly than does water.
